2023 ICD-10-CM Diagnosis Code Y03.0

Assault by being hit or run over by motor vehicle

    2016 2017 2018 2019 2020 2021 2022 2023 Non-Billable/Non-Specific Code
  • Y03.0 should not be used for reimbursement purposes as there are multiple codes below it that contain a greater level of detail.
  • The 2023 edition of ICD-10-CM Y03.0 became effective on October 1, 2022.
  • This is the American ICD-10-CM version of Y03.0 - other international versions of ICD-10 Y03.0 may differ.
ICD-10-CM Coding Rules
  • Y03.0 describes the circumstance causing an injury, not the nature of the injury.

    External causes of morbidity

    Note
    • This chapter permits the classification of environmental events and circumstances as the cause of injury, and other adverse effects. Where a code from this section is applicable, it is intended that it shall be used secondary to a code from another chapter of the Classification indicating the nature of the condition. Most often, the condition will be classifiable to Chapter 19, Injury, poisoning and certain other consequences of external causes (S00-T88). Other conditions that may be stated to be due to external causes are classified in Chapters I to XVIII. For these conditions, codes from Chapter 20 should be used to provide additional information as to the cause of the condition.

    Assault

    Includes
    • homicide
    • injuries inflicted by another person with intent to injure or kill, by any means
    Type 1 Excludes
    • injuries due to legal intervention (Y35.-)
    • injuries due to operations of war (Y36.-)
    • injuries due to terrorism (Y38.-)
